Start With a Clear Cleanup Plan

Every successful cleanup begins with a plan that outlines what needs to be done. Without a clear direction, it is easy to waste valuable time. Identifying the areas to be cleaned and setting priorities helps keep efforts on track. Breaking the project into smaller sections prevents burnout and confusion. A structured approach allows consistent movement instead of rushed decisions. Planning also helps anticipate the type of waste that will be generated.

A plan also helps determine the most efficient workflow. Tackling larger or messier areas first often makes the rest of the cleanup feel easier. Knowing where items will go before starting reduces delays. This preparation minimizes pauses during the project. When each step is intentional, efficiency improves naturally. A clear plan sets the tone for a smoother cleanup experience.

Organize Items Before Disposal

Sorting items early in the cleanup process saves energy. Separating items into categories such as retain, remove, or dispose helps maintain organization. This step prevents confusion once removal begins. Handling items only once reduces fatigue and keeps momentum going. Sorting also makes it easier to identify what truly needs to be removed. The clearer the categories, the faster decisions are made.

When sorting is skipped, cleanups often slow down due to second-guessing. Pausing repeatedly to decide what to do with each item interrupts workflow. A structured sorting system eliminates hesitation. It also helps prevent clutter from being moved without purpose. With clear categories, each item has a destination. This clarity keeps the cleanup moving efficiently.

Create an Efficient Cleanup Workspace

An organized workspace makes cleanup tasks more efficient. Clearing pathways and designating staging areas reduces unnecessary movement. Tools and supplies should be within reach to avoid constant searching. When everything has a place, productivity increases. An orderly setup also reduces the risk of accidents or damage. Organization supports a steady and focused workflow.

Workspace organization also helps manage fatigue and efficiency. When movement is efficient, less effort is wasted. This is especially important during larger cleanups that require sustained effort. Keeping the workspace tidy throughout the process prevents clutter from rebuilding. Small adjustments can have a big impact on efficiency. A clean workspace supports a faster cleanup overall.

Tackle Cleanups One Section at a Time

Breaking a cleanup into sections makes the project feel more manageable. Completing one area at a time provides visible progress. This sense of accomplishment keeps motivation high. Section-based work also helps track what has already been completed. It prevents areas from being overlooked or revisited unnecessarily. Momentum builds when progress is clear.

Working in sections also improves focus. Each section can be tackled with a specific goal in mind, helping tasks stay clearly defined from start to finish. This structure prevents tasks from blending together and causing confusion. It also allows for short breaks between sections without losing focus. Organized progress keeps energy levels balanced and reduces unnecessary fatigue.
